When Should My Child Have Their Initial Dental Visit?



For a lot of children, it's recommended to schedule their initial dental visit by the age of one to make sure proper dental healthcare from an early age. This early check out allows the pediatric dental practitioner to keep track of the development of your youngster's teeth, give support on appropriate dental health practices, and detect any type of potential problems early on. It likewise helps your child become aware of the dental office environment, reducing anxiousness throughout future brows through.


Throughout the first oral see, the dental expert will examine your youngster's mouth, gum tissues, and any kind of arising teeth. They'll likewise go over crucial subjects such as teething, appropriate nutrition for dental health and wellness, and how to avoid dental caries. The dental expert might show exactly how to clean your child's teeth correctly and resolve any concerns or issues you may have regarding your kid's oral wellness.

What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?



Usual pediatric dental treatments usually include regular cleanings, oral fillings, and fluoride therapies. Routine cleanings are essential for maintaining your youngster's dental wellness by removing plaque and tartar buildup that can lead to dental caries and gum illness. These cleansings are usually carried out by a dental hygienist that'll additionally give valuable tips on appropriate dental hygiene methods for your youngster.

Fluoride treatments are another usual treatment in pediatric dental care. Fluoride helps to enhance the enamel of the teeth, making them more immune to degeneration. These treatments are usually advised by dental practitioners to help protect against tooth cavities and preserve good oral health.

Exactly How Can I Aid My Child With Oral Hygiene in your home?



To help preserve your kid's oral health between dental brows through, making sure appropriate dental health in your home is crucial. Begin by instructing your child the relevance of brushing their teeth a minimum of tw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Monitor them while cleaning to make sure they're using the proper strategy and reaching all areas of their mouth. Motivate them to spit out the tooth paste as opposed to swallowing it.

Along with brushing, make flossing a day-to-day behavior for your youngster, specifically when their teeth begin to touch. Flossing helps remove food particles and plaque from in between the teeth where a toothbrush can't get to. Consider utilizing enjoyable seasoned floss or floss choices to make the procedure extra satisfying for your child.

Limitation sugary snacks and drinks in your youngster's diet to avoid tooth cavities. Go with water as the major beverage and deal healthy treats like fruits, vegetables, and cheese. Lastly, timetable normal dental exams to ensure your kid's dental health is on track.
